Abstract


This paper introduces the concept of QR codes, an automatic method to hide information using QR codes and to embed QR codes into colour images with bounded probability of detection error.The embedding methods are designed to be compatible with standard decoding applications and can be applied to any colour or gray scale image with full area coverage. The embedding method consists of two components. First is the use of halftoning techniques for the selection of modified pixels to break and reduce the coarse square structure of the QR code and second is the luminance level to which the pixels are to be transformed in such a way that it should not visible to naked eye on the colour image. Further to decode the QR code from the color image with minimum errors. we are giving Text/URL’s of any website as an Input to PC in HyperTerminal as a command to ARM micro controller through USB device and the image is processed by using image processing technique in PNG Format (the given URL or Text is converted as a image in PNG format).
